头痛!mysql和postagesql的对比!

[复制链接]
查看11 | 回复4 | 2005-12-16 09:47:56 | 显示全部楼层 |阅读模式
现在公司准备上一个新的系统,考虑到成本问题,打算采用Mysql、Postagesql中的一种,现在老板要我给一个对比的情况出来,因为我一直是做Oracle dba的,对这两款产品没有接触过,所以只有到这里来问一问,用哪一种比较好。
回复

使用道具 举报

千问 | 2005-12-16 09:47:56 | 显示全部楼层
要对比哪些因素呀?
回复

使用道具 举报

千问 | 2005-12-16 09:47:56 | 显示全部楼层
如果你只关心处理速度的话,优先考虑mysql,其它方面建议考虑PostgreSQL。目前的mysql还不支持存储过程和触发器,要到5.0版才支持存储过程,5.01版才支持触发器,过了很长时间了,目前仍然是5.0 α测试版,β版还没见到,也许是支持存储过程、触发器、完整事务与它以往的高速之间不好协调吧。PostgreSQL在Linux上很成熟了,目前在windows上可单独安装的是8.0的测试版,主要是代码移植的兼容性。你还可考虑一下Firebird,一个在InterBase上发展起来的东东。说实话,个人认为PostgreSQL与Firebird在数据库方面要比mysql强的多,任何一个有规模的系统,如果其数据库端没有存储过程和触发器的话,就意味着没有真正成熟的系统规划,那些单凭在网络上跑sql语句的所谓大系统简直可笑!
回复

使用道具 举报

千问 | 2005-12-16 09:47:56 | 显示全部楼层
如果你只关心处理速度的话,优先考虑mysql,其它方面建议考虑PostgreSQL。目前的mysql还不支持存储过程和触发器,要到5.0版才支持存储过程,5.01版才支持触发器,过了很长时间了,目前仍然是5.0 α测试版,β版还没见到,也许是支持存储过程、触发器、完整事务与它以往的高速之间不好协调吧。PostgreSQL在Linux上很成熟了,目前在windows上可单独安装的是8.0的测试版,主要是代码移植的兼容性。你还可考虑一下Firebird,一个在InterBase上发展起来的东东。说实话,个人认为PostgreSQL与Firebird在数据库方面要比mysql强的多,任何一个有规模的系统,如果其数据库端没有存储过程和触发器的话,就意味着没有真正成熟的系统规划,那些单凭在网络上跑sql语句的所谓大系统简直可笑!
回复

使用道具 举报

千问 | 2005-12-16 09:47:56 | 显示全部楼层
关注
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行